Egypt says it's doing enough to prevent Gaza arms flow
Source: Agence France-Presse
February 12, 2007
Egyptian officials on Sunday dismissed Israeli criticism that Egypt is not doing enough to prevent the flow of terrorist arms through its territory and into the Gaza Strip.
An unnamed official claimed Cairo was effectively patrolling the border, and insisted that the Israeli complaints were nothing more than an effort to undermine Egypt's role as a peace broker.
According to Israeli defense officials, vast quantities of explosives, rockets and small arms have been smuggled into Gaza since Israel handed control of the border over to Egypt and the Palestinian Authority in September 2005.
They warn that if the smuggling continues, Gaza will soon be as heavily armed as Hizb'allah-controlled southern Lebanon was before last summer.
